Bail Bonds and Expungement: Are They Associated?

People typically ask whether making bond helps or harms a future expungement. The brief answer is that bail and expungement stay in the exact same criminal case timeline, but they do different tasks. Bail is about getting out of custodianship and showing up to court. Expungement is about cleansing records after the situation ends. They intersect in position that matter: how an instance was fixed, whether you complied with court orders, and what the document claims in staff systems and history databases. Treat them as different tools that, if utilized intelligently, can sustain each other.

Two tracks in the exact same case

Bail choices take place promptly, generally within 24 to 72 hours after an arrest. A court thinks about trip danger and public security. You may be released by yourself recognizance, pay a cash money bond, utilize a bail bondsman, or remain in custody if the cost is non-bailable or you have holds from various other jurisdictions. That decision is about seeing to it the instance can proceed.

Expungement occurs later on. Each state establishes its own regulations for clearing or sealing records. Some enable expungement just after a termination or acquittal. Others allow it after a conviction as soon as you finish probation and wait a defined number of years. A few states utilize "securing" as opposed to "expungement," and some only hide records from public view without completely destroying them. Federal documents, migration documents, and specific terrible or sex offenses usually sit outside typical expungement schemes.

The throughline is habits and result. How you manage your situation while out on bond can form the last personality, and that personality regulates expungement qualification. Bail does not create a right to expungement, but good performance on bond often maintains doors open.

What a bond actually does

A bond is a warranty. If you are launched, the court expects you to show up and follow conditions: no brand-new https://franciscocqec458.tearosediner.net/just-how-social-network-can-influence-your-bail-status arrests, keep away from particular individuals or areas, test clean if ordered, preserve employment or school, sign in with pretrial solutions. If you utilize an industrial bail bondsman, you pay a costs that is commonly nonrefundable. In several states it runs concerning 10 percent of the bond quantity, in some cases reduced for big bonds or co-signed setups. The bail bondsman is not component of the prosecution or the court, however they bring risk. If you miss out on court, they can look for to surrender you, and the court can surrender the bond.

From the expungement viewpoint, a clean pretrial run helps. Courts bear in mind when an accused makes every look and causes no problem. Prosecutors do also. That a good reputation can convert right into better appeal offers, earlier terminations, or diversion programs. Those results issue since expungement rests on them.

The path from bond to outcome to record clearing

Think regarding the process as a sequence:

    Arrest, reservation, initial look with a bond decision. Pretrial period while out on bond or in custody, consisting of activities and discovery. Resolution: termination, diversion, pardon, or conviction. Post-judgment commitments: probation, classes, restitution. Waiting duration and qualification look for expungement or sealing.

Each stage leaves finger prints in the record. The arrest document is produced at reservation. The court docket shows hearings, filings, and bond postings. Personality access identify the resolution. Expungement greatly targets those fingerprints, specifically the apprehension access and docket recommendations. The much better the resolution, the extra complete the cleaning can be.

Examples help. In a theft instance, a defendant posted a small bond and went into a pretrial diversion contract. She finished a theft-awareness class, paid restitution, and remained arrest-free for 6 months. The prosecutor disregarded the charge. After a statutory waiting period of 60 to 180 days, she requested to remove the arrest and the charge. Since she conformed throughout, including while on bond, the court granted expungement with little fuss.

Contrast that with a battery case where the offender uploaded bond, missed out on two hearings, and picked up a new arrest while on launch. The prosecutor withdrew a diversion offer. He pled to a violation with 12 months of probation and a stay-away order. He completed probation yet needed to wait a number of years prior to ending up being qualified to secure the record, and in his state the underlying arrest continued to be noticeable to specific firms. Very same first action, very various outcome.

Bail bonds do not count as regret or innocence

A reoccuring mistaken belief is that uploading bond is an admission of misbehavior, or that paying a bail bondsman will appear in ways that block expungement. It does not function like that. Bail is step-by-step, not substantive. The truth that a bond was set, published, or waived does not confirm the fee. Courts deal with bond records as component of the case file, yet expungement statutes ask different questions: Held true rejected? Existed a sentence? Did you complete conditions? Are you within the eligible crime listing? Meeting those tests relies on the personality and conformity, not on just how you funded your release.

Where bond becomes relevant is habits. If you violate bond conditions, you can collect brand-new charges like failing to appear, bail jumping, or ridicule. Those are independent offenses. Also if the initial cost is later on disregarded, the failure to show up could stand and complicate expungement. In some states, a separate failure-to-appear sentence blocks expungement of the original apprehension. In others, it just extends the waiting duration. This is the silent link between bonds and expungement that customers overlook: it is not the bond, it is what you do while on bond.

Diversion, postponed adjudication, and just how bond performance feeds them

Prosecutors and courts commonly condition diversion or delayed adjudication on conformity with pretrial terms. If you are on time, adhere to time limits, test tidy, and communicate, you resemble a winner for alternatives. Diversion programs often bring about terminations. Deferred adjudication, made use of in numerous states, keeps back a conviction while you full problems. After completion, the situation can be dismissed or converted into a conviction relying on performance.

Why does that matter? Many expungement statutes make terminations promptly qualified for expungement or enable securing of delayed situations after a short waiting period. A sloppy pretrial record can remove these options. A mindful one can unlock them. The bond just provides the area to develop that record outside a prison cell.

Background checks and exclusive databases

Another point of complication: people expect an expungement to wipe every mention of an instance from the internet. Government data sources normally abide as soon as the court orders expungement, yet exclusive background sites and information brokers are stubborn. They commonly scuffed the details at the time of apprehension or arraignment and keep it till they are informed to remove it. Several states call for exclusive screeners to utilize one of the most existing documents and to upgrade within a defined period after a customer disagreements accuracy. That process can take weeks. Having the expungement order in hand provides you the leverage. Whether you posted a bond does not change your take advantage of, but hold-ups in your situation can mean even more time for those sites to replicate your apprehension data.

When asked exactly how to decrease digital footprint, I advise customers to ask for a certified copy of the expungement order and send it to significant customer coverage firms with their disagreement channels. Some law practice and record-clearing services will do targeted takedowns. It is not instant, yet most clients see an obvious enhancement within one to 3 months.

Money, expenses, and trade-offs

There is an economic fact to bail and expungement. Publishing a cash money bond ties up cash but is refundable if the situation ends without forfeiture, minus charges in some territories. Using a commercial bail bondsman sets you back a costs you will not get back. If you expect a fast termination or a likely non-custodial appeal, there can be a logical disagreement to publish a cash money bond if you can afford it, especially on smaller sized bond quantities under a couple of thousand dollars. On higher bonds, lots of people select a bail bondsman to avoid straining family finances.

Expungement applications lug their very own prices: filing charges, fingerprinting, certified mail to companies, and occasionally lawyer time. In lots of states, costs range from a few hundred dollars to over a thousand, depending on the variety of cases and whether hearings are called for. Courts might forgo costs for indigent petitioners. The earlier you prepare for expungement, the better you can protect records, collect dispositions, and conserve for the process.

Clients in some cases ask if paying for a bond before employing a defense attorney is a blunder. The sensible response is that flexibility aids the defense. You can function, attend meetings, and collect evidence. But if funds are restricted, talk with counsel about concerns. In a low-level case most likely headed for launch on recognizance within a day, it could be smarter to save the bond costs and concentrate on legal strategy. In an instance where detention can last weeks, bonding out can avoid task loss and childcare turmoil that surge into appeal decisions.

State-by-state traits and timing traps

Expungement regulation is federalism at its most granular. Differences that look small on paper can alter end results. A few patterns to know:

    Some states permit expungement of apprehensions that did not cause costs, usually after a short waiting duration. If you bonded out, and the prosecutor never filed, you might qualify quickly. Many states bar expungement of sentences for criminal activities of violence, specific felonies, or offenses entailing residential violence. Bond standing is pointless, personality is everything. Deferred judgments can be expunged earlier than straight convictions, but a single offense of bond or probation can transform a deferred situation into a conviction that might never ever be expunged. Waiting periods begin at different times: from arrest day, from dismissal, or from conclusion of probation. Missing out on court can push all go back, since a warrant quits the clock. Some states distinguish between expungement and securing. Companies and property owners could not see closed cases, yet licensing boards and police often still can. Know which fix you are in fact getting.

These peculiarities describe why a neighbor's story about a quick expungement could not relate to your instance, even if the costs audio similar. The initial bond decision remains a step-by-step step, however your conduct while out on bond connects with these policies in manner ins which can aid or hurt your lasting record.

What a bail bondsman can and can refrain from doing for expungement

Bondsmen occupy a narrow lane. They can upload guaranty, screen court dates, and sometimes advise you of commitments. They can not give lawful suggestions regarding expungement timing, qualification, or begging options. Some might refer you to lawyers or record-clearing solutions. Watch out for pledges that a bond purchase "includes expungement." At ideal, a bondsman can give documents that assistance later on, like proof of bond exoneration after the situation concludes. Those papers show you fulfilled the participation requirement, yet judges seldom require them if the court docket currently shows looks and resolution.

There is one practical benefit numerous ignore: bondsmen track court dates fanatically to prevent forfeit. Their tips reduce failures to appear. Fewer failures suggest less warrants, fewer bond cancellations, and fewer added fees. That ripple effect can be the difference in between a clean dismissal and an endangered appeal that limits record relief.

Arrest records after a dismissal: do you still require expungement?

Even when a case is disregarded, the arrest and court entry stay visible in lots of public systems up until you actively clear them. Employers and proprietors often quit at the word "apprehension," without excavating into the disposition. If you bonded out, the general public docket might show "bond posted," "bond vindicated," and the last "rejected" entry. Without expungement or securing, those entries can continue for many years. That is why many defense attorney treat expungement as the last step in the case, not as an optional add-on. Termination is an excellent end result. Removing the path is better.

A nuance here: some states automatically secure disregarded situations without an application, often called automated document alleviation. Even in those territories, history screeners may lag, and some courts still call for a short activity to correct roaming access. Checking your record three to 6 months after dismissal is a smart habit.

Expungement after conviction: does bonding out still matter?

If your case ends in a sentence, whether you bonded out could really feel pointless. It is not totally unimportant. Judges consider the whole image when determining optional expungement applications. Laws usually call for courts to weigh recovery, conformity, and neighborhood ties. Completing bond conditions without case, then finishing probation, then staying arrest-free, paints a meaningful tale that supports alleviation. Conversely, a conviction layered with failure-to-appear and bond cancellations can make a court hesitant, even if the law practically permits expungement.

In my data, the customers who bound out, kept secure job, complied with therapy strategies, and completed probation on time tended to secure expungement at the earliest possible eligibility day. The regulation established the guardrails, however the narrative brought weight. When a district attorney items, that narrative can move an optional judge.

Handling the paperwork trail

When going for expungement, hoard paper. Courts shed data. Agencies misfile dispositions. The even more you can show, the smoother the procedure. Useful documents consist of the arrest report or event number, scheduling number, last personality, proof of completed programs, proof of restitution payment, bond exoneration notification, and any type of order dismissing the instance. If your situation involved several counts with different results, see to it the personality covers each matter. An expungement application that overlooks a matter commonly causes a denial or a request to modify, which includes months.

I recommend clients to request licensed duplicates of the last judgment or order within a week of personality. Clerks are much faster when the file is fresh. Waiting years can suggest archived documents and longer retrieval times. If you relocated states, set up a plan for notarized trademarks and remote hearings if allowed.

Immigration and licensing side notes

If you are not a united state person, talk with an immigration attorney prior to consenting to any kind of appeal or diversion. Expungement usually does not heal migration consequences, because federal immigration decisions check out the underlying conduct and initial situation documents, regardless of later sealing. A bond that enabled you to go into diversion could still leave an impact that matters to migration. Timing your expungement to accompany applications for advantages is a strategic decision that requires expertise.

For specialist licensing, expungement assists but does not assure invisibility. Medical, lawful, monetary, and security-clearance boards typically ask for any kind of previous apprehensions and dispositions, even if removed. Answering untruthfully can be a lot more destructive than the underlying infraction. That said, presenting an expungement order with proof of compliance and rehabilitation typically pleases a board's issues, specifically for low-level, non-violent matters.

How to think about strategy

If you are being in a holding cell, method feels abstract. Below is a sensible frame that has actually served clients well:

Start by obtaining legal counsel early. A short examination clarifies whether your instance is likely to lead to release on recognizance, a reduced cash money bond, or an opposed bond hearing. If guidance expects you to be launched on recognizance rapidly, it may be reasonable to wait and conserve cash for defense or future expungement fees. If detention looks most likely to extend, bonding out protects work and family life, which can indirectly enhance case results.

Treat pretrial problems like a probation trial run. Do what the order states, paper conformity, and keep evidence. If you get a diversion deal, weigh it against long-term ramifications: some diversions require admissions that impact migration or licensing, while others cause clean dismissals with superb expungement prospects.

Think in advance to the document. Ask your legal representative whether your anticipated end result is expungeable or sealable, and when. Mark that day on a schedule. If your state needs a waiting period, set tips 6 months before to collect documents.

Finally, do not neglect small step-by-step errors like a missed out on court day. Fix them right away. A fast abandonment and rescheduled hearing can avoid a failure-to-appear fee that would otherwise haunt an expungement request later.

The short response to the lengthy question

Bail bonds and expungement are connected only in the way that all parts of a situation belong. One is about where you wait while the system chooses your situation. The other has to do with what the public can see after the system has made a decision. The bridge in between them is conduct and end result. Good conduct on bond usually generates much better outcomes, and better end results generate more powerful expungement civil liberties. Poor conduct does the opposite.

If you maintain that chain in mind, the decisions you make on day two of an instance can protect your alternatives on day 7 hundred, when you prepare to rebuild your online footprint and pass a history check. Flexibility during the instance is important. A clean record afterward is transformative. With mindful handling, you can have both.
